Six celebrated Tampa Bay breweries are set to participate in a special presentation focused on what continues to be called a phenomenon: craft beer.

Mark DeNote, Florida Beer News editor and author of The Great Florida Craft Beer Guide, will discuss "Brewing Up Business: The Wonders of Small Business with Florida Breweries" at Pasco County's Saint Leo University. Hosted by the School of Arts and Sciences at 6:30 p.m. Feb. 9, the event will take place in the Greenfelder-Denlinger Boardrooms of the Student Community Center.

Following DeNote's presentation, representatives from Angry Chair Brewing, Barley Mow Brewing Company, Saint Somewhere Brewing Company, 7venth Sun Brewery, Coppertail Brewing Co. and Cigar City Brewing will participate in a panel discussion, plus a Q&A. The 21-and-up event also plans to feature beer samples and light bites while supplies last.
